How do fish use Archimedes Principle?

Archimedes’ principle states that the buoyant force on an object is equal to the weight of the water it displaces. If the fish were much denser than water (or saltwater, as the case may be), the weight of the displaced water would be much less than the fish’s weight, and the fish would sink.

What helps fish control buoyancy?

The swim bladder, gas bladder, fish maw, or air bladder is an internal gas-filled organ that contributes to the ability of many bony fish (but not cartilaginous fish) to control their buoyancy, and thus to stay at their current water depth without having to waste energy in swimming.

Which organ is used for buoyancy control in fish?

swim bladder, also called air bladder, buoyancy organ possessed by most bony fish. The swim bladder is located in the body cavity and is derived from an outpocketing of the digestive tube.

How do cartilaginous fish achieve buoyancy?

Chondrichthyes (cartilaginous fish) use an oil filled liver to control their buoyancy. The oil lightens the shark’s heavy body to keep it from sinking and saves the sharks energy when using its fins to keep itself moving. These organs can help them stay neutrally buoyant.

How do fish without swim bladders keep from sinking?

Fish With No Bladders Their skeleton is lighter than that of bony fish, and they carry oil in their livers; oil is usually lighter than water, providing a bit of buoyancy. Their stationary pectoral fins create a certain level of buoyancy when combined with forward movement.

Does fish sink or float?

Most fish are slightly denser than water, so sink immediately after death. However, like a drowned human, they become more buoyant over time as bacterial decomposition produces gases inside the body. Usually, enough gas builds up in body cavities to make the corpse float, like an inflated balloon.

How do fish inflate their swim bladder?

Fish can inflate the swimbladder by gulping atmospheric air from the surface of the water and passing it through this connection. Deep water fish that do not encounter the surface of the water have a single chambered swimbladder (physoclistous) that is regulated by the circulatory system.
